Reducing the Perception of Bias
What is it?
Selecting the anonymous grading option hides student names from graders when they view assignment submissions in SpeedGrader.
Why is it important?
Excellent tool when there are multiple instructors for a course, and to protect the anonymity of the grading instructor.
How do I do it?

Open Assignments

In Course Navigation, select the Assignments link.
Add Assignment

To create an assignment with all assignment details at the same time, select the Add Assignment button.
Edit Assignment

If you want to edit an existing assignment that has not yet received student submissions, select the name of the assignment.
Add Assignment Details

Add details to the assignment.
Select Anonymous Grading

Select the Graders cannot view student names checkbox.
Note: If the moderated grading assignment option is also enabled, anonymous grading includes an additional option for graders to not view each other's names.
Save Assignment

If you want to notify users about any future assignment changes, select the Notify users that this content has changed checkbox [1].
Select the Save button [2].
Note: If your assignment is not yet published, the assignment displays the Save & Publish button. Selecting the Save button creates a draft of your assignment so you can publish it later.
